As brands grow and scale, so does the complexity of managing design assets, guidelines, and consistency across teams. That’s why one of the most common questions our portfolio company Corebook° gets is:

“What’s the difference between Digital Asset Management (DAM) and Brand Asset Management (BAM), and which is right for me?”


In a recent article, Corebook° breaks down the distinction and makes a compelling case for Brand Asset Management as the go-to solution for modern teams. While DAM platforms serve as essential libraries for storing and accessing digital files, they often lack the context and creative alignment needed to maintain a unified brand presence.

Corebook° offers a BAM solution that integrates brand guidelines directly with assets, empowering design, marketing, and content teams to collaborate more effectively and stay consistently on-brand.


Key advantages of Corebook°'s BAM system include:

  • Live, interactive brand guidelines

  • Contextual asset linking for smarter usage

  • AI-powered asset tagging and search

  • Secure, time-sensitive sharing features

  • Centralized collaboration across teams and regions


Whether you’re going through a rebrand, launching campaigns across markets, or just want to eliminate the chaos of outdated brand decks, Corebook° gives your team the tools to build and protect brand equity at scale.
